THERE are more train delays this morning due to a signalling problem in the New Forest.

Passengers travelling on the Lymington line have been warned that a signalling problem between Brockenhurst and Lymington means trains will travel at a reduced speed on all lines.

Train services running to and from these stations may be cancelled or delayed by up to five minutes, a spokesperson for South West Trains said.

Disruption is expected until at least 11.30am.

The spokesperson added: "An ongoing signalling issue continues to impair the Lymington line.

"Most trains will only sustain small delays on their journey, however, occasionally, a service will have to be cancelled to allow a system to reset. We are continuing to explore solutions to this issue.

"We are sorry for the disruption to your journey."
